Itraconazole (Antifungal) — Patient-Friendly Guide
Itraconazole is an antifungal medicine used to treat a range of fungal infections. It works by stopping fungi from making essential substances they need to survive. Because fungal infections can involve different organs and severities, itraconazole may be prescribed in different forms and dosing schedules.
This guide is designed to help you understand how itraconazole works, how it is usually taken, important interactions, and practical safety advice. Always follow the instructions given to you for your specific condition.

How itraconazole works (mechanism of action)
Itraconazole belongs to the triazole class of antifungals. It inhibits an enzyme called lanosterol 14α-demethylase (a key step in fungal cell membrane production).
By blocking this step, the fungus cannot produce ergosterol, an essential component of its cell membrane. As a result, fungal growth is slowed and infections can resolve.
Pharmacokinetics (how the body handles itraconazole)
“Pharmacokinetics” describes how itraconazole is absorbed, distributed, metabolised, and removed from the body. Understanding these points can help explain why timing, formulation, and interactions matter.
Absorption
Absorption can vary depending on the formulation (capsules versus oral solution) and on stomach acidity. In general:
- Capsules are better absorbed when taken with food.
- Oral solution may absorb better when taken on an empty stomach (often described as taken without food).
- Medicines that reduce stomach acid can reduce absorption for some itraconazole products.
Distribution
Itraconazole distributes into tissues where fungal infections may occur, including skin and mucosal sites. It may take time for tissue concentrations to build up, which is why some fungal infections require longer courses.
Metabolism
Itraconazole is metabolised primarily in the liver and interacts with other medicines by affecting liver enzymes. This is one reason it has many clinically important interactions.
Elimination
Itraconazole is eliminated more slowly than many other medicines, and its levels can persist after stopping treatment. The “tail” effect may influence interaction risk even after your last dose.
Typical uses (indications) in the UK context
Itraconazole is used to treat infections caused by susceptible fungi. The exact choice of antifungal depends on: the type of fungus, infection site, severity, patient health, and local guidance.
Common clinical indications include
- Systemic fungal infections (where fungi affect internal organs)
- Fungal infections of the skin and nails (depending on the organism and location)
- Vaginal candidiasis in selected situations where an oral option is considered
- Other invasive or less common fungal infections where itraconazole is appropriate
Note: Some fungal infections may require urgent specialist care, combination therapy, or longer courses. Your clinician will balance benefits and risks for your individual situation.
When and how to take itraconazole (timing and practical scheduling)
Timing depends strongly on whether you are using capsules or oral solution, as well as your prescribed dose. If you are unsure which formulation you have, check the pack label or ask your pharmacist.
General timing tips
- Take it at the same times each day to keep steady drug levels.
- If you miss a dose, do not double up unless told to by a healthcare professional.
- Complete the course even if you start to feel better—fungal infections may take time to clear.
Food and formulation considerations
Food and gastric acidity can influence itraconazole absorption:
- Capsules: usually taken with food to improve absorption.
- Oral solution: may be taken without food (or as directed) to improve absorption.
If you switch between capsules and oral solution, or change how you take them with meals, absorption may change. Keep your routine consistent unless instructed otherwise.
Duration of treatment
Treatment length can vary widely:
- Some skin infections may improve within weeks, but full resolution can take longer.
- Nail fungal infections often require prolonged therapy because nails grow slowly.
- Systemic infections can require extended courses and close monitoring.
Food interactions and stomach-acid effects
Itraconazole absorption depends on stomach acidity. Medicines that change stomach pH may reduce drug levels and effectiveness. Particular classes include:
- Proton pump inhibitors (PPIs) (e.g., omeprazole, lansoprazole, pantoprazole)
- H2-receptor antagonists (e.g., famotidine, cimetidine)
- Antacids (depending on timing and formulation)
- Reduced gastric acidity from other causes may also affect absorption
If you use medicines for reflux, heartburn, or ulcer symptoms, let your pharmacist know. They can advise on whether timing separation or alternative therapies are needed.
Alcohol and medicine interactions
Alcohol does not typically have a single “direct” interaction with itraconazole in the same way as some other drugs, but both alcohol and itraconazole can affect the liver.
Practical advice
- If you drink alcohol, aim for moderation.
- Avoid heavy or binge drinking while taking itraconazole, especially if you have liver disease.
- Seek medical advice promptly if you develop signs of liver problems (see safety section below).
Other medicine interactions involving metabolism
Itraconazole is a strong inhibitor of certain liver enzymes and transport systems. This can increase the levels of some other medicines, raising the risk of side effects. It can also be affected by medicines that induce liver enzymes, reducing itraconazole levels.
Because of this, it is essential to inform your healthcare professional about all medicines you use, including herbal products and supplements.
Common medicine interactions (key examples)
The list below highlights common interaction themes. This is not exhaustive. Always check with your pharmacist if you start, stop, or change any medication.
Medicines that may reduce itraconazole levels
- Rifampicin (tuberculosis medicine)
- Certain anticonvulsants (e.g., phenytoin, carbamazepine)
- Some antiviral medicines (e.g., certain HIV therapies)
- St John’s wort (herbal remedy)
Medicines whose levels may increase with itraconazole
- Some statins (cholesterol-lowering medicines)—interaction risk varies by specific statin
- Some antiarrhythmics and medicines affecting heart rhythm
- Benzodiazepines and other sedatives (depending on the specific drug)
- Some anticoagulants (risk depends on which anticoagulant)
Medications affecting the heart rhythm
When itraconazole is combined with medicines that can affect heart rhythm (QT prolongation), the risk of abnormal heart rhythm may increase. Your prescriber/pharmacist will consider your medicines carefully.
Dosing: what to expect
Itraconazole dosing depends on the indication, fungal type, severity, and your formulation. In practice, dosing may be:
- Daily regimens
- Pulse regimens (short courses followed by rest) in some nail conditions
- Adjusted courses for specific conditions or in people at higher risk
Because dosing varies, the most accurate information is the dose written on your label. Special considerations for dosing
- Liver impairment: itraconazole should be used with caution, and monitoring may be needed.
- Heart failure: itraconazole can be a concern in people with or at risk of heart failure.
- Age: older adults may have higher interaction risk due to multiple medicines.
- Formulation differences: capsules and solution are not interchangeable on a mg-for-mg basis in all cases.
Safety profile: important warnings and side effects
Like all medicines, itraconazole can cause side effects. Many people experience mild effects and continue treatment. However, some reactions require prompt medical attention.
Seek urgent medical advice if you notice
- Symptoms of severe allergy such as swelling of the face/lips, sudden wheezing, or difficulty breathing
- Signs of liver injury including yellowing of the eyes/skin, dark urine, severe fatigue, persistent nausea/vomiting, or upper right abdominal pain
- Severe skin reactions such as blistering rash, peeling skin, or sores in the mouth
- New or worsening shortness of breath, swelling in legs/feet, or sudden weight gain (possible heart failure-related concerns)
Common or mild side effects
- Headache
- Nausea, stomach upset, abdominal discomfort
- Diarrhoea or constipation
- Rash or itching
- Temporary changes in taste
- Fatigue
If side effects are troublesome or persistent, speak to a pharmacist or prescriber.
Risk factors to discuss
- Liver disease or history of abnormal liver tests
- Heart failure or significant cardiac history
- Use of many interacting medicines
- Reduced stomach acidity medicines (PPIs/H2 blockers/antacids)

Alternative options (what else may be considered)
Choice of antifungal depends on the infection site, organism, severity, and patient factors. Depending on your diagnosis, alternatives may include other antifungals such as:
- Fluconazole (often used for certain yeast infections)
- Terbinafine (commonly used for dermatophyte skin/nail infections)
- Voriconazole or Posaconazole (for selected serious fungal infections)
- Amphotericin B (for certain severe infections under specialist care)
- Topical antifungals (for some skin or limited nail surface infections)
In the UK, clinicians select antifungals using local antimicrobial guidance, infection severity, and susceptibility patterns. Your pharmacist can explain why itraconazole is chosen for your specific condition.

FAQ — Frequently asked questions
1) Is itraconazole for yeast infections, mould infections, or both?
Itraconazole is effective against a variety of fungi, including yeasts and moulds, depending on the organism and the infection site. Your clinician selects it based on the most likely fungus and the condition being treated.
2) Should I take itraconazole with food?
It depends on the formulation. Many itraconazole capsules are taken with food to improve absorption. The oral solution often has different food guidance. Check your pack instructions and follow them carefully.
3) Can I take omeprazole or other acid-reducing medicines with itraconazole?
Acid-reducing medicines (such as PPIs and H2 blockers) can affect itraconazole absorption. Don’t start or stop these medicines without advice. Your pharmacist can help you plan timing or choose alternatives where necessary.
4) What should I do if I miss a dose?
Take it as soon as you remember unless it’s close to your next dose. In general, do not double the dose. If you’re unsure, contact a pharmacist for advice based on your schedule.
5) How long will it take to start working?
Improvement timelines depend on the infection type and location. Some symptoms may improve within days to weeks, but fungal infections can require longer treatment for complete clearance, especially for nails.
6) Can I drink alcohol while taking itraconazole?
Light to moderate alcohol may be possible for some people, but alcohol can increase strain on the liver. If you have liver issues or notice liver-related symptoms, avoid alcohol and seek advice.
7) Are there medicines I must avoid?
Certain medicines and herbal products may significantly interact with itraconazole or affect its effectiveness. Tell your pharmacist about everything you take, including OTC products and supplements.
8) What symptoms might suggest liver problems?
Contact a healthcare professional urgently if you develop yellowing of the skin/eyes, dark urine, persistent nausea or vomiting, severe tiredness, or pain in the upper abdomen—especially while taking itraconazole.
9) Does itraconazole interact with statins or blood thinners?
It can. The interaction risk depends on the specific statin or anticoagulant. Your pharmacist can check for compatibility and advise whether a dose adjustment or alternative is needed.
10) Are nail and skin infections treated the same way?
Not necessarily. Nail infections often require longer treatment due to the growth cycle of nails, and dosing schedules may differ. Skin infections may improve sooner, depending on the organism and extent.
